Aston Business School logoApplications are now open for this year’s Aston Programme for Small Business Growth.

This free scheme will help 28 business leaders from a range of sectors develop their leadership skills and build targeted growth strategies for their own businesses.

The programme involves workshops, one-to-one support and networking opportunities. It aims to enable early stage business leaders achieve sustainable growth and will run from January to June 2017, with workshops delivered predominantly in central Birmingham.

The selected participants will complete the programme together, sharing their experiences and strategies, building a supportive network and working with an experienced mentor to tackle any issues or challenges their businesses face as they grow. It is a practical programme and participants will come away with a growth strategy that they have written for their own business and an action plan to achieve their growth goals.

The scheme is fully funded by Aston University and the European Regional Development Fund. To be eligible, you must be responsible for the growth strategy of an SME with an operational base in the Black Country, Coventry and Warwickshire or Greater Birmingham and Solihull LEP regions. Your business must have been running for at least a year, have at least one full time employee and have potential for growth.
